Mead at 0.999

13.5%-ish ABV!  During the course of first month, the 1.111 original gravity mead fermented down to just under water in thinness.  This means lots of alcohol, with nothing left to ferment.  (probably time to rack to another gallon carboy.)

And it was basically undrinkable!  Like drinking rubbing alcohol or something worse.  But be patient... give it another 11 to 21 months and it may be awesome.  It will be awesome!
